Board Up Service in Olathe, KS
Board up services provide a temporary protective solution for properties that have sustained damage or are at risk of further harm. This service involves securely covering windows, doors, or other vulnerable openings with sturdy materials such as plywood or other weather-resistant panels. It is commonly requested during emergency situations like storms, vandalism, or break-ins, as well as after events that result in structural damage, to prevent additional harm and unauthorized access while repairs are arranged.
Property owners typically want to understand the scope of coverage, including which areas can be safely and effectively boarded up, and how long the coverings will remain in place. It is important to consider factors such as the type of damage, weather conditions, and the property's security needs before requesting this service. Properly executed boarding can help protect the property from weather elements, theft, and further deterioration until permanent repairs are completed.

Board Up Service Questions
What is board up service? It involves covering windows and openings with plywood or other materials to secure a property after damage or vandalism.
When should board up services be used? They are typically used after storms, break-ins, or other incidents that leave windows or doors broken or exposed.
What types of properties can benefit from board up services? Residential homes, commercial buildings, and vacant properties can all utilize board up services for protection.
What materials are used for board up services? Plywood is most common, but other sturdy materials may be used depending on the situation and property needs.
